David Meerman Scott has written something similar to what Doc Searls has been saying for a long time now - marketing is about personal communications, and the "mass media" model is a recent thing. What the web is doing now is returning the old style to prominence:
Instead of making everything "new," the Web has brought communications back full circle to where we were 60 years ago. On the Web you can finally communicate again in the way that people respond to. What people respond to, and the way they make purchase decisions, really hasn’t changed at all.
